摘要 PURPOSE:To shorten machining time by outputting laser output command for piercing after the lapse of a specific distance from the state of deceleration at the time of movement control from the end position of cutting to the state position of the next cutting. CONSTITUTION:A machining head is accelerated between the time t0 and t1, is moved at a specified speed between the time t1 and t2 and is further decelerated between the time t2 and t3 in order to move the head to the next cutting start point after ending of a specific cutting. The positioning to the cutting start point is in succession executed between the time t3 and t5. A piercing start position is determined when the deceleration start at the time t2 is detected. The position advanced by the set distance from the deceleration start point is determined as the piercing start position by using the set distance previously stored in a memory. This set distance is so set that the piercing is completed simultaneously with the completion of the positioning of the cutting start point. As a result, the time required for the piercing is made substantially zero and the machining time is surely shortened.
